Surgical Carbide Burs, Cylindrical Fissure, HP 107-012


Clinical Overview
Surgical carbide burs are designed for precise cutting and shaping of hard dental tissues. They enhance efficiency and accuracy during surgical procedures, making them essential tools in dental surgery.

Indications
- Cutting and shaping of enamel and dentin.
- Preparation of cavities for restorative procedures.
- Accessing root canals in endodontic treatments.
- Resection of hard tissue during surgical interventions.
Instructions for Use
- Select the appropriate bur for the procedure.
- Attach the bur securely to the handpiece.
- Adjust the speed settings as required for the procedure.
- Begin cutting with controlled pressure to achieve desired results.
- Periodically check the bur for wear and replace as necessary.
